    Eating & Drinking: Wonderful Wines and Liquors!!!
  • Tip Rating:
  • Huge wine and liquor warehouse. A great place to find a gift! Shop for wines, beer, and spirits of all types here! There is also a gourmet section of over 250 cheeses, fine olive oils and meats. There are frequent tastings here, too!

    The staff here is very helpful and informed, so ask questions to find what you're looking for.

    The last time I was here, there was a tasting of the "Jonesy" port from Australia. It had a great taste and was a fabulous deal. I bought some and had it signed by Jonesy himself!

    Mitsuwa!!!: Japan in Chicago?!?
  • Tip Rating:
  • Curry Rice with Egg and Hamburger - Chicago
    Curry Rice with Egg and
    Hamburger
    by Marisola
    Send Photo to a Friend
    Mitsuwa is a giant supermarket that sells everything Japanese! Go there to find whatever you're missing that you can only find in Japan, and I'm sure they've got it! If you've never been to Japan, here's a first step to see how it will be like. Everything is in Japanese, but most items have an extra label printed in English here, which you won't find in Japan! There is also a small liquor store, a bakery and a huge restaurant/cafeteria area where you can eat authentic Japanese foods for a decent price! You can also see the plastic food entrees before you order them!

    My favorite is going through the sweets aisle to look for different candies... I also like looking at all of the different snack chips... drinks... etc.! I like trying new things, so I spend a lot of time in each aisle. The Japanese udon / ramen noodles I bought were the best I've ever had, and the restaurant is great!

    Cheaper than Japan, so live it up!

    Books & Music: Good spot for used books
  • Tip Rating:
  • Powell's Bookstore in Hyde Park, Chicago - Chicago
    Powell's Bookstore in Hyde
    Park, Chicago
    by Jefie
    Send Photo to a Friend
    Powell's Bookstore started out in 1970 when Michael Powell, a University of Chicago graduate student, borrowed $3,000 to open up his first bookstore. Two months later, Powell had repaid his loan and over the years, the little business has expanded to include two more locations in Chicago. I went to the one located in the Hyde Park area, close to the University of Chicago campus. It is described as the most scholarly of the three stores, and I thought there was a great selection of classic and contemporary literature. Within 15 minutes I already had my arms full of books and had to make some really tough decisions to make sure my suitcase would hold it all. In the end I narrowed it down to three novels, which I got for $5 each. Next time I need to bring an extra suitcase!

    Most novels were in good condition and seemed to go for about a third of the original price.

    Various: Devon Avenue
  • Tip Rating:
  • Devon Avenue is the "Little India" section of Chicago, filled with Indian restaurants, sweet shops, stores selling exotic jewelry and beautiful saris.

    We only spent about a 1/2 hour walking around because we didn't have much time, next time we will walk a little further than we did and check out some more of the shops and stop for some Indian food.

    We visited on November 6th, the area around Devon was getting ready for the Indian holiday of Diwali or Deepawali (Festival of Lights) on November 12.

    We stopped by a sweet shop called Sukhadia's Sweets at 2559 W. Devon that was very crowded, we were the only non Indians in the place. We asked some of the folks waiting in line what we should try and they were very nice to try and help us, but even after eating it I'm still not sure what most of it
    is.

    One I know that we tried was jalebi, spirals of fried chickpea batter in sweet syrup. it had a very interesting flavor, almost like eating fried honey.
